Shrub Trimming in Honolulu, HI
Shrub trimming services involve the careful shaping and reduction of shrubbery to maintain a neat and healthy appearance around residential properties. This service covers a variety of projects, including shaping hedges, reducing overgrown bushes, removing dead or diseased branches, and ensuring shrubs do not obstruct walkways or windows. Homeowners typically request shrub trimming to enhance curb appeal, promote healthy growth, and prevent pests or disease from taking hold in dense foliage. It’s important for property owners to consider the specific types of shrubs on their property and communicate their desired shape and size to achieve the best results.
Before requesting shrub trimming services, property owners should evaluate the current condition of their shrubs and determine their maintenance goals. Clarifying whether the focus is on aesthetic shaping, health improvement, or clearance can help guide the trimming process. Additionally, understanding the growth patterns and seasonal needs of different shrub varieties can influence the timing of service. Proper communication about the scope of work and desired outcomes ensures that the trimming aligns with property standards and personal preferences.

Shrub Trimming Questions
What types of shrubs benefit from trimming? Shrubs that are overgrown, have dead or damaged branches, or need shaping are ideal candidates for trimming to promote healthy growth and improve appearance.
When is the best time to trim shrubs? The optimal time for trimming depends on the shrub species, but generally, late winter or early spring is suitable for most deciduous plants, while flowering shrubs are best trimmed after blooming.
Why is regular shrub trimming important? Regular trimming helps maintain the shrub’s shape, encourages dense growth, and prevents disease by removing dead or diseased branches.
What tools are used for shrub trimming? Common tools include pruning shears, hedge trimmers, and loppers, selected based on the size and type of shrub being trimmed.
